    My problem with buying one expensive item is, what if I end up not liking it? With the tags are on, you do not know how the fabric will behave during your normal day (will it slip, stretch, rub...), whether the shoe will remain comfy even when you run for the bus, whether the cashmere is not too thin and will not start deteriorating... or, more like, you probably know it, I do not :) Because even the price or brand does not seem to reflect and guarantee quality. From this point of view, it is easier to buy a few items that are trendy, unwashable, not rotate them heavily and donate when done with them. It is a problem that needs to be dealt with.

    • @mimaesthetic2517
      @mimaesthetic2517 5 років тому

      Dominique 1. Shoe shopping at the end of the day when get have expanded a bit. Then wear around the house on clean floors... Maybe put a plastic bag around your feet lol. 2. Same thing with clothes. however, when mistakes are made I write them down, articulate exactly why did item was a terrible idea and my future purchases have less mistakes to them.

    • @Kelbel5995
      @Kelbel5995 5 років тому

      This is a great question--it just takes time and practice. It's true that price doesn't necessarily equate to quality (which is frustrating)! I second everything that @MimAesthetic said. Also, I'd add that it helps to read reviews online to see what others have said about the durability. And when you buy something from a new brand, buy something that you like but is relatively inexpensive (for the brand). If it deteriorates, you know that brand is not high quality and you can avoid it in the future.
      I think that switching to good quality is a process, and there are bound to be some mistakes along the way--but don't let that deter you!
